Septic Installation Service in Denver, CO
Septic installation services involve setting up a wastewater management system for properties that are not connected to municipal sewer lines. This process includes selecting the appropriate type of septic system, preparing the site, and ensuring proper placement to meet local regulations. Property owners typically request these services when building a new home, replacing an existing system, or upgrading an outdated setup to ensure efficient and reliable waste disposal.
Before requesting septic installation, property owners should consider factors such as the size of the property, soil conditions, and future household needs. Understanding the necessary permits, local codes, and the overall scope of the project helps in planning a successful installation. Consulting with experienced service providers can clarify the options available and ensure the system is designed to accommodate current and future usage.

Septic Installation Service Questions
What is involved in septic installation? Septic installation includes assessing the property, designing the system, and properly installing the tank and drain field to ensure proper waste management.
How do I know if my property needs a new septic system? Signs include persistent odors, slow drains, or pooling water near the drain field, indicating that a new system may be necessary.
What types of septic systems are available? Common options include traditional gravity systems, pressure distribution systems, and alternative designs tailored to property conditions.
What should property owners consider before installing a septic system? Factors include property size, soil conditions, and local regulations to ensure the system is suitable and compliant.
